2016-06-13 - Updated through online information from Brian McKee. <br>I have served as a guest organist several times in April, May and June, 2016. The organ is perfectly maintained and used weekly. The organ has an Antiphonal division of exposed pipes in the rear of the sanctuary, as well as the exposed pipes in the front. The Antiphonal was added after the original organ and has another 4 ranks of pipes. -Database Manager
